Haemophilia B, also spelled hemophilia B, is a blood clotting disorder causing easy bruising and bleeding due to an inherited mutation of the gene for factor IX, and resulting in a deficiency of factor IX. It is less common than factor VIII deficiency (haemophilia A). [3] Haemophilia B was first recognized as a distinct disease entity in 1952. [4]

Defective connective tissue leads to fragile capillaries, resulting in abnormal bleeding, bruising, and internal hemorrhaging. Collagen is an important part of bone, so bone formation is also affected. Teeth loosen, bones break more easily, and once-healed breaks may recur. Aplastic anemia causes a deficiency of all blood cell types: red blood cells, white blood cells, and platelets. [5] [6] It occurs most frequently in people in their teens and twenties but is also common among the elderly. It can be caused by immune disease, or by exposure to chemicals, drugs, or radiation.
